MICHAEL J. KELLY, Presiding Judge.

Mary Glover appeals by leave granted pursuant to MCR 7.205(D) an Ingham Circuit Court order affirming the Parole Board's denial of parole from her sentences of life imprisonment. We reverse the circuit court's decision, and remand for further proceedings.
